Manoj Kumar is a renowned Indian actor, director, and producer known for his work in Bollywood. He is celebrated for his patriotic films and significant contributions to Indian cinema.
Manoj Kumar was born as Harikishan Giri Goswami on July 24, 1937, in Abbottabad, then part of British India. He moved to Delhi with his family during the partition in 1947.
Manoj Kumar is married to Shashi Goswami, and the couple has two sons, Vishal and Kunal. He is known for leading a relatively private life, away from the limelight.
Manoj Kumar made his acting debut in 1957 and gained fame with his patriotic films like "Shaheed," "Upkar," and "Purab Aur Paschim." He received several awards, including the Padma Shri and Dadasaheb Phalke Award.
Manoj Kumar was awarded the Padma Shri in 1992 and the Dadasaheb Phalke Award in 2015 for his outstanding contributions to Indian cinema. He also won several Filmfare Awards throughout his career.
While Manoj Kumar largely maintained a clean public image, he was involved in a legal dispute with the makers of the film "Om Shanti Om" over a spoof of his character, which was later resolved.
Some of Manoj Kumar's iconic films include "Upkar," "Purab Aur Paschim," "Roti Kapda Aur Makaan," and "Kranti." These films are celebrated for their patriotic themes and social messages.
